AURETB002

Analyse and evaluate electrical and electronic faults in dynamic control management systems

Application

This unit describes the performance outcomes required to analyse and evaluate electrical and electronic faults in embedded network dynamic control management systems in vehicles or machinery in order to initiate action to sustain, vary or enhance performance. It involves identifying, evaluating, selecting, justifying and documenting the most appropriate rectification method or variation to the rectification method.

The unit includes the analysis of multi-system and intermittent faults which may be caused by operating in adverse conditions. These systems include the functions of an electronic braking control module (EBCM), such as anti-lock braking, brake assist, descent control, electronic brake force distribution, electronic park brake, hill start assist, stability control, traction control and active roll-over protection.

It applies to those working in the automotive service and repair industry on embedded network dynamic control management systems of vehicles or machinery.

No licensing, legislative, regulatory or certification requirements apply to this unit at the time of publication.
